BR03 YUP is a 2012 Chevrolet Spark in Silver with a 995cc petrol engine. This vehicle has been through 21 MOT tests with a personal pass rate of 57.1%.
Across all 2012 Chevrolet Spark models, the average MOT pass rate is 69.8% with a typical mileage of 49,022 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Chevrolet Spark f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 3,137 recorded failures. If you're considering buying BR03 YUP, it's worth having these areas checked by a mechanic before committing.
The Chevrolet Spark typically stays on UK roads for around 16 years. At 14 years old, this Chevrolet Spark is approaching the upper end of the typical lifespan for this model.
